Webb12 dec. 2024 · “Normal” is similar to low on common slow cookers, while the “More” mode corresponds to medium-high. Here are the approximate temperatures for the slow cooker function: Low – 170 to 190 degrees Fahrenheit Normal – 195 to 205 degrees Fahrenheit More – 200 to 210 degrees Fahrenheit Instant Pot Slow Cooker Lid Webb12 dec. 2024 · Slow cooker pots are ideal for cooking dishes that require extended periods under low heat. A slow cooker, also known as a crock-pot (after a trademark owned by Sunbeam Products but sometimes used generically in the English-speaking world), is a countertop electrical cooking appliance used to simmer at a lower temperature than other cooking methods, such as baking, boiling, and frying. This facilitates unattended cooking …
